    How to Convert Square millimeter (mm²) to Varas conuqueras cuad:

    1 Square millimeter (mm²) = 1.59017e-7 Varas conuqueras cuad
    1 Varas conuqueras cuad = 6288632.9999999497 Square millimeter (mm²)

    For Example: Convert 15 Square millimeter (mm²) to Varas conuqueras cuad:
    15 Square millimeter (mm²) = 15 × 1.59017e-7 Varas conuqueras cuad = 2.38526e-6 Varas conuqueras cuad
